> 2) The ACPI PCI slot detection driver would change the slot names of
> some hotplug drivers (at least I checked shpchp and pciehp). And
> the name of slots are depending on the order of driver loading.
> For example, on my system which has several SHPCHP slots and
> PCIEHP slots, the name of PCIEHP slots are changed as
> follows. Please note that PCIEHP based slots are 0034_0027 and
> 0032_0026, and others are SHPCHP based slots.
>
> - Without ACPI PCI slot detection driver
> # ls /sys/bus/pci/slots/
> 0009_0016 0014_0018 0019_0020 0021_0022 0034_0027
> 0011_0017 0016_0019 0021_0021 0032_0026
>
> - With ACPI PCI slot detection driver
> # ls /sys/bus/pci/slots/
> 0009_0016 0014_0018 0019_0020 0021_0022 27
> 0011_0017 0016_0019 0021_0021 26
>
> I had thought it is not a big problem before because people who
> don't like new names would not load the PCI slot driver. But since
> it is loaded automatically at boot time, I'm wondering that it
> would be a problem. For example, some platform, not fujitsu,
> depends on the old slot name to work, IIRC (Maybe Kristen knows
> the background about it). And I don't think the fact that slot
> names are changed depending on the order of driver loading is
> acceptable by system management people/software, though I don't
> have such software.
>
> Though I don't have any specific idea about this, folliwings might
> be candidates.
>
> - Override slot names with hotplug driver's slot names

I think this should be done - if the pci slot driver detects that a
hotplug driver is controlling a slot, it should allow that driver to
set the name of the slot.

> - Unify slot names among all hotplug drivers

I'm not sure if we can do this, since slot name might depend on what
spec people are implementing.

> - Stop automatic loading of ACPI PCI slot driver

I think we should definitely implement this one ^^^.
